• PostgreSQL 不仅仅是一个简单的关系数据库;它是一个数据管理框架,有可能吞没整个数据库领域。 “一切皆用 Postgres”的趋势不再局限于少数精英团队,而是正在成为主流最佳实践。
  • pg_analytics 是一个扩展,可将任何 Postgres 数据库的本地分析性能提高 94 倍。安装 pg_analytics 后,Postgres 的速度比 Elasticsearch 快 8 倍,在分析基准测试中几乎与
  • 这是一个PostgreSQL数据库的查询工具。虽然有数据库浏览器,但它并不用于创建/删除数据库或表。资源管理器是一种视觉辅助工具,可帮助您制定查询。 有一种语言服务最多应保持一个与数据库打开的连接(假设选择了一个连接)。这有利于查询诊断、代码完成和 icon
  • 本教程将使我们全面了解如何在 PostgreSQL JSONB列中存储 JSON 数据。 我们将快速回顾一下如何使用JPA处理存储在可变字符 ( VARCHAR ) 数据库列中的 JSON 值。之后,我们将比较VARCHAR类型和JSONB类型之间的差异, icon
  • UUID通常用作数据库表主键。它们易于生成,易于在分布式系统之间共享并保证唯一性。 考虑到 UUID 的大小,这是否是一个正确的选择值得怀疑,但通常这不是由我们决定的。 本文的重点不是“ UUID 是否是键的正确 icon
  • 本周Github八个有趣的项目、工具和库包 1、GarnetGarnet icon
  • 与以搜索为中心的数据库相比,Postgres 全文搜索存在不足的九个领域的概述。 什么是全文搜索?全文搜索是指将部分或全部文本查询与数据库中存储的文档进行匹配。与传统的数据库查询相比,全文搜索即使在部分匹配的情况下 icon
  • 在本文中,我们将探讨TimescaleDB ,这是一个构建在PostgreSQL之上的开源时间序列数据库。我们将深入研究其特性,检查其功能,并讨论如何有效地与该数据库交互。 什么是TimescaleDBTimesc icon
  • 许多分布式数据库讨论的重点都是分布式查询规划、事务等方面的算法。这些都是非常有趣的话题,但事实上,作为一名分布式数据库工程师,我只有一小部分时间花在算法上,而过多的时间花在了在各个层面进行非常谨慎的权衡上(当然还有故障处理、测试、修复错误)。 icon
  • 这篇文章介绍了Cloudflare如何通过使用PostgreSQL、PgBouncer、HAProxy和Stolon等工具来实现高扩展性和高可用性,应对多租户数据库环境中的性能隔离和负载均衡的挑战。他们使用连接池、流量控制算法和优先级队列等技术来限制和优化数据库连接,并通过数据复制和故障转移 icon
  • 大量的表读取可能会导致我们的应用程序内存不足。它们还会给数据库增加额外的负载,并且需要更多的带宽来执行。读取大型表时推荐的方法是使用分页查询。本质上,我们读取数据的子集(页面),处理数据,然后移动到下一页。 在本文中,我们将讨论并实现使用JDBC进行分页的 icon
  • Expedia Group是世界领先的在线旅游平台之一,他们开发了一个工具,帮助用户使用Kafka、Postgres和WebSockets查询和获取实时流数据,并通过Web浏览器获取实时事件 他们面临的挑战是处理大量和高速的数据流,传统的方法无法实 icon
  • 在 Tembo(,我们希望拥有一个客户数据仓库来跟踪和了解客户的使用情况和行为。我们希望快速回答​​诸如 “我们部署了多少个 Postgres 实例?”、 “谁是我们最活跃的客户?”之类的问题。以及 “截至目前我们有多少注册用户?”。 为了做到这一点 icon
  • PostgresBSON :一个新的实验性扩展,为Postgres引入了BSON支持。BSON是起源于MongoDB的数据格式。 此 PostgreSQL 扩展实现了 BSON 数据类型,以及创建和检查 BSON 对象的函数,以实现表达和高性能查询 icon
  • VirtusLab 的基于事件溯源的 Akka 应用程序的底层数据库迁移案例研究。 这篇文章介绍了一项针对大型工业事件溯源项目的研究,其中涉及了对Akka和数据库选择的讨论。 作者对Akka Persis icon
  • 这篇博文讨论了 PostgreSQL 中多版本并发控制的基础知识。然后介绍快照以及它们如何控制元组的可见性。还讨论了与表扫描 API 的集成。 与许多关系数据库管理系统一样,PostgreSQL 使用多版本并发控制(MVCC)来支持并行运行的事务, icon
  • transqlate 使用 AST 将 SQL 语段从一种方言转译成另一种方言 将 Oraclisms 翻译为 PostgreSQL 方言 处理标识符大小写 保留空格、大小写和注释 一流的错误报告 解析脚本或任何表达式 具有语法突出显示 icon
  • 事件表:id   | status   | icon